What a Contractor Installs With a New Water Heater

The tank is the center of the system. It sits in a utility space, garage, or closet and holds the water that gets heated and sent through the house. The inlet valve brings cold water in, and the pressure relief valve sits on the side of the tank as a safety device.
The flue or exhaust vent runs from the top of the unit and exits through the wall or roof, carrying combustion gases out of the home. A drain valve sits near the base of the tank, and the anode rod rides inside it, protecting the tank lining from corrosion.
The drawing shows a typical layout, and a licensed contractor determines exactly what applies to your home and its setup.
